Vanilla Syrup

Ingredients
  

  • 2.5 cups water
  • 2 cups granulated sugar
  • ½ cup brown sugar I have used Mawana premium soft brown sugar
  • 2 tsp vanilla essence

Instructions
 

  • Take a heavy-bottomed saucepan. Add water, granulated sugar and brown sugar in it.
  • Heat it over a medium flame/heat. Bring it to a boil.
  • Then reduce heat and let it simmer for 8-10 minutes or until the syrup thickens a little (The syrup thickens significantly as it cools, so don’t cook it for too long).
  • Turn the heat off and pour vanilla essence. Mix well.
  • Allow it to cool down to room temperature. Then pour it into a glass jar or bottle.
  • Place it in the refrigerator and you can use it for up to 2 weeks.
